Graduate Diploma in Human Rights Law at University of Melbourne Fees
The University of Melbourne Graduate Diploma in Human Rights Law fee structure includes first-year tuition fee that all the students have to pay. Apart from the tuition fee, the students also have to spend money on stay, food and other utilities, which comprises cost of living, which is AUD 14,522. The total expense may vary, depending on the additional charges provided by The University of Melbourne. The total first-year tuition fees of Graduate Diploma in Human Rights Law is AUD 28,000.

Graduate Diploma in Human Rights Law at University of Melbourne Entry Requirements
- No specific cutoff mentioned
- 70%
- Read less
- To be considered for entry into this course, applicants must have completed a degree in law (LLB, JD or equivalent) leading to admission to practice with a University of Melbourne equivalent score of at least 70 or
- A degree in law (LLB, JD or equivalent) leading to admission to legal practice and at least one year of documented, relevant professional experience or
- An undergraduate degree in a relevant discipline and at least one year of documented, relevant professional work experience
- Disciplines relevant to this course include human rights or law
- Professional experience relevant to this course includes roles such as public servant, policy or research officer, or political advisor, and roles in charities or not for profits
